Charge your new battery fully before you use it for the first time. Over the next few charge cycles, run your device down to around 20% before you recharge—this helps the battery perform its best. After that, charge whenever you need to.
🔹 Keep It Healthy
Avoid letting your battery completely drain or staying plugged in constantly. Both extremes wear it out faster. Store the battery in a cool, dry place when you're not using it, since heat damages batteries quickly.

Welch-Allyn Connex ProBP 3400 — 3.7V Li-ion Replacement Battery (BATT11)
This is a 3.7V, 2200mAh Li-ion cell for the Welch-Allyn Connex ProBP 3400 and Connex ProBP 3400 Pro BP blood pressure monitors. It fits the same slot as OEM part BATT11 (also listed as part 6911). Capacity is rated at 8.14Wh and matches the original cell specification.
- Connex ProBP 3400 platform fit: The 3400 and 3400 Pro BP share the same battery bay, connector pinout, and BMS communication protocol. Both accept this cell without modification. The Otoscope listing under the same OEM part number uses an identical form factor and voltage rail.
- Bench tested on actual hardware: We ran this cell through charge and discharge cycles on the Connex ProBP 3400 platform. The BMS accepted the cell, completed charge handshake, and reported state-of-charge correctly after the first full cycle.
- Post-swap startup protocol: After fitting this battery, allow the device to complete its full power-on self-test without interruption. The Connex ProBP 3400 runs a BMS verification sequence at startup — cutting power during this window logs a persistent battery fault that does not clear until the next clean reboot.
Low battery alarm on a freshly charged Connex ProBP 3400
The Connex ProBP 3400 BMS uses a chemistry fingerprint from the OEM cell to set its alarm threshold. A new replacement cell has not yet completed a full charge-discharge learn cycle, so the BMS may read state-of-charge conservatively and trigger the low battery alarm even when the cell is near full. Run one complete charge to termination, then discharge through normal device use before clinical deployment. After that first cycle, the BMS threshold aligns to the actual cell chemistry and the false alarm stops.
Connex ProBP 3400 will not power on after replacement battery sat in storage
Li-ion cells self-discharge during storage. If this battery was stored for several months before installation, its resting voltage may have dropped below the Connex ProBP 3400 BMS recovery threshold — typically around 2.5V per cell — causing the device to refuse to boot. Connect the device to mains power via the AC adapter first, without pressing the power button. The charge IC will apply a low-current pre-charge to bring the cell voltage back above the recovery threshold. Once the charge indicator shows activity, allow a full charge cycle to complete before powering on.

Frequently Asked Questions
The Connex ProBP 3400 shows a battery fault on screen right after I installed a new cell — is the battery dead?
It is not dead. The Connex ProBP 3400 runs a BMS verification sequence during power-on self-test, and if that sequence was interrupted — even briefly — the device logs a persistent fault against the battery. Power the unit fully off, refit the battery, and allow the device to complete its startup cycle without touching any buttons. If the fault clears after a full reboot, the cell is fine. If it persists, connect to AC power and run one complete charge cycle before drawing any conclusion.
The charge indicator on my Connex ProBP 3400 has been at the same level for hours and will not reach 100% — what is happening?
The charge IC in the Connex ProBP 3400 applies a conservative current limit on a new or cold cell it has not characterised yet. This can make the final stage of charge appear stalled, especially on the first cycle. Leave the device connected to the AC adapter and do not interrupt the charge. The IC is still working — it shifts to trickle current in the top 10–15% of charge, which looks like no progress on the indicator. Let it complete fully; the cell voltage at termination should read approximately 4.2V.
My Connex ProBP 3400 is cutting off unexpectedly mid-use even though the battery showed a good charge level — what causes that?
New Li-ion cells have higher internal resistance in the first ten cycles, which causes voltage to sag under the load spikes the ProBP 3400 generates during a blood pressure measurement cycle. The BMS reads that momentary voltage dip as a low-cell condition and triggers a protective shutdown, even if the displayed charge level looked acceptable. This is not a faulty cell — it conditions out as internal resistance drops over the first several charge-discharge cycles. Run the battery through five to ten full cycles before clinical use and the cutoffs will stop.
